"Great for quick break"
Quick break organised by husband - worried before went but really pleased with Sardinia and hotel. Hotel bit of a walk from town but quickly got used to local transport and enjoyed the bus rides. Longest we had to wait was coming out of town about 9.00 pm - half hour wait and bus pretty full - but at least it arrived. Hotel very clean and friendly. Room small and balcony at back overlooking residential who were a bit noisy early in am, but preferred it to constant traffic noise. Breakfast quite adequate. Market well worth a visit - just down the road toward front - on Wednesday am, goes on for miles. Not usual tacky tourist stuff. Lunches in Alghero really great value especailly Il Ghiotto - cellar restaurnt near the fish restaurant opposite where you get boat to the grotto - real good value. Boat to grotto good - but don't forget the 13 euro doesn't include entry to the grotto - that's another 10 euro - but it's all well worth it. Got train into Sassari - good insight into their train system - reliable but in need of upgrading, although clean - just looked like they were due to be scrapped! Asked for help finding 'centro' and people really friendly. All in all and great break and only 2 hours flying time away.
